Debate over the helpfulness of anti-aging drugs and supplements like DHEA, HGH (human growth hormone) and a host of others has raged for the past several years. HGH is extremely expensive, so only very rich people can get it, but there are a lot of other pro-hormones and supplements that people take to try and slow the aging process. While some of these may have a very slight effect, most are a waste of money and the AMA has just released a statement to that fact. The truth is, that absent real disease, the best anti-aging formula is found in a healthy lifestyle and not in a bottle. Eating right, exercising, getting enough sleep and de-stressing your life are by far the most effective anti-aging methods. There are some men and women that need hormone replacement therapy as they get older, but that is a relatively small group- and most would not need it if they followed my diet, exercise, sleep and de-stress formula. But as a whole, people usually want to take a pill rather than change their bad habits and lifestyle. So, be honest with yourself and admit that there are a lot of things you can change without resorting to dangerous drugs and supplements.

CHICAGO – The American Medical Association says there’s no scientific proof to back up claims of anti-aging hormones.
At their annual meeting in Chicago on Monday, AMA delegates adopted a new policy on products such as HGH, DHEA and testosterone used as aging remedies.
With HGH, or human growth hormone, the AMA says evidence suggests long-term use can present more risks than benefits. The risks include tissue swelling and diabetes.
